I. PROPOSED ADOPTION OF THE 2025 H SHARE AWARD AND TRUST SCHEME

The Board has resolved at a meeting of the Board held on March 17, 2025 to propose the adoption of the 2025 Scheme. The 2025 Scheme shall be effective upon the approval by the Shareholders at the 2024 AGM. The grant of Awards to the Selected Participants under the 2025 Scheme shall be subject to the fulfillment of the conditions as determined by the Board and/or the Delegatee to be set out in the Award Letter. Please refer to the section headed "Condition of the Grant of Awards" below for further details. The principal terms of the 2025 Scheme are set out below and the full set of the proposed 2025 Scheme Rules is set out in the appendix to this announcement.

Dr. Ge Li, Dr. Minzhang Chen, Mr. Edward Hu, Dr. Steve Qing Yang and Mr. Zhaohui Zhang, being executive Directors who are expected to be potential Connected Selected Participants of the 2025 Scheme, may have material interest in the 2025 Scheme and have abstained from voting on the relevant Board resolutions in relation to the 2025 Scheme. Save for Dr. Ge Li, Dr. Minzhang Chen, Mr. Edward Hu, Dr. Steve Qing Yang and Mr. Zhaohui Zhang, there is no other director who is required to abstain from voting on the Board resolutions in relation to the 2025 Scheme.


  • 2 -

Purposes of the 2025 Scheme

The purposes of the 2025 Scheme are:

(i) to attract, motivate and retain highly skilled and experienced personnel to strive for the future development and expansion of the Group by providing them with the opportunity to be further incentivized by equity interests in the Company, more directly associated with the equity performance of the Company;

(ii) to modernize the Company's remuneration practices and to better align with the interests of the Shareholders while seeking a balanced approach in the operational and executive management oversight; and

(iii) to (a) recognize the contributions to the Company of the prudent management of the Company including the Directors; (b) encourage, motivate and retain the leadership of the Company whose collective contributions are beneficial to the continual operation, development and long-term growth of the Group; and (c) introduce additional incentive for the management of the Company by aligning the interests of the management of the Company to that of the Shareholders and the Group as a whole.

The Directors are of the view that the individual performance indicators as conditions for the vesting of the Awards will serve to achieve the purposes stated above.

Duration

Subject to any early termination of the 2025 Scheme pursuant to the 2025 Scheme Rules, the 2025 Scheme shall be valid and effective for ten years commencing from the date on which the 2025 Scheme is approved by the Shareholders at the 2024 AGM (after which no further Awards will be granted), and thereafter for so long as there are non-vested Award Shares granted under the 2025 Scheme prior to the expiration of the 2025 Scheme, in order to give effect to the vesting of such Award Shares or otherwise as may be required in accordance with the provisions of the 2025 Scheme Rules.

Source of Funds

The source of funds for funding the 2025 Scheme is the internal funds of the Company.


  • 3 -

Source of Award Shares and acquisition of H Shares by the Scheme Trustee

The source of the Award Shares under the 2025 Scheme shall be H Shares to be acquired by the Scheme Trustee through on-market transactions at the prevailing market price in accordance with the instructions of the Company and the relevant provisions of the 2025 Scheme Rules.

The Company shall as soon as reasonably practicable, for the purposes of satisfying the grant of Awards, transfer to the Trust the necessary funds and instruct the Scheme Trustee to acquire H Shares through on-market transactions at the prevailing market price. The Scheme Trustee shall as soon as reasonably practicable thereafter proceed to acquire such number of H Shares as instructed by the Company on-market at the prevailing market price.

The acquisition of H Shares by the Scheme Trustee will be done independently of, and possibly concurrently with, other dealings of A Shares or H Shares by Shareholders which could be a Director or a member of the senior management, while being subject to dealing restrictions imposed by applicable laws and regulations (including but not limited to the Listing Rules and the Rules Governing the Listing of Stocks on Shanghai Stock Exchange).

Any excess funds provided by the Company shall not automatically form part of the funds of the Trust and shall be refunded to the Company if written direction to that effect is received by the Scheme Trustee within 30 days of the date of completion of the transfer of the relevant H Shares to the Scheme Trustee.

The Company shall instruct the Scheme Trustee whether or not to apply any Returned Shares to satisfy any grant of Awards made, and if the Returned Shares, as specified by the Company, are not sufficient to satisfy the Awards granted, the Company shall, as soon as reasonably practicable, for purposes of satisfying the Awards granted, transfer to the Trust the necessary funds and instruct the Scheme Trustee to acquire further H Shares through on-market transactions at the prevailing market price.

Scheme Limit

Subject to the 2025 Scheme Rules, the Scheme Limit shall be the maximum number of H Shares that will be acquired by the Scheme Trustee through on-market transactions from time to time at prevailing market price with funds in the amount of not more than HK$2.5 billion, and in any event the maximum number of H Shares to be so acquired by the Scheme Trustee shall be determined by the Board and/or the Delegatee and which shall in any event not render the Company unable to maintain the public float as required under the Listing Rules, as modified by the waiver granted by the Stock Exchange upon the Listing. The Company


proposed to set the Scheme Limit in terms of the total amount of funds that it will provide to the Scheme Trustee to acquire H Shares through on-market transactions together with a limit on the number of H Shares which can be so acquired by the Scheme Trustee in order to (i) regulate the costs of the Company in setting up the 2025 Scheme; and (ii) provide Shareholders with clarity on the financial outlay on the 2025 Scheme and the maximum number of H Shares underlying the 2025 Scheme.

For illustrative purpose, based on the average closing price of the H Shares as stated in the Stock Exchange's daily quotations sheets for the sixty trading days immediately preceding March 14, 2025 (being the trading day before the date of this announcement) of HK$57.6225 per H Share, the maximum number of H Shares that can be purchased with funds in the amount of HK$1.5 billion (assuming only the Basic Condition of Grant (as defined below) can be satisfied) for the purpose of the 2025 Scheme would be 26,031,498 H Shares, while the maximum number of H Shares that can be purchased with funds in the amount of HK$2.5 billion (assuming both the Basic Condition of Grant and the Additional Conditional of Grant (as defined below) can be satisfied) for the purpose of the 2025 Scheme would be 43,385,830 H Shares. The ultimate number of H Shares to be purchased for the purpose of the 2025 Scheme will depend on the then prevailing price of the H Shares and the fulfillment of the Conditions of Grant (as defined below), and shall be subject to the determination of the Board and/or the Delegate. As such, for the avoidance of doubt, the abovementioned numbers may not be equivalent to the ultimate number of H Shares to be purchased for the purpose of the 2025 Scheme and are for illustrative purpose only.

The Company shall not make any further grant of Awards which will result in the aggregate number of H Shares underlying all grants made pursuant to the 2025 Scheme (excluding Award Shares that have been forfeited in accordance with the 2025 Scheme) to exceed the Scheme Limit without Shareholders' approval. The Scheme Limit shall not be subject to any refreshment.

Conditions of the Grant of Awards

The grant of Awards to the Selected Participants shall be subject to the fulfilment of the conditions as determined by the Board and/or the Delegate to be set out in the Award Letter. In this regard, the Board would like to inform the Shareholders that, if the 2025 Scheme is approved by the Shareholders, the Executive Committee of the Company, to whom the Board will delegate its authority to administer the 2025 Scheme, will set the conditions for the grant of Awards to the Selected Participants to take effect as (i) the revenue realized by the Group for the year 2025 being RMB42 billion or above (the "Basic Condition of Grant"), and (ii) the revenue realized by the Group for the year 2025 being RMB43 billion or above (the "Additional Condition of Grant"), and together with the "Basic Condition of Grant", the "Conditions of Grant"). If only the Basic Condition of Grant can be satisfied, no more than 60% of the Scheme Limit (i.e. HK$1.5 billion) can be utilized for the grant of Awards to be Selected Participants. If both of the Basic Condition of Grant and the Additional Condition of Grant can be satisfied, the entire Scheme Limit can be utilized for the grant of awards to the

  • 7 -

Selected Participants. If the Condition(s) of Grant cannot be satisfied, the relevant grant of Awards to such Selected Participants which corresponds to the unsatisfied Condition(s) of Grant will not take effect.

Subject to the fulfillment of the Basic Condition of Grant only, the amount of Awards to be granted to Connected Selected Participants shall not exceed 25% of 60% of the Scheme Limit. Subject to the fulfillment of both the Basic Condition of Grant and the Additional Condition of Grant, the amount of Awards to be granted to Connected Selected Participants shall not exceed 25% of the entire Scheme Limit. The particulars of the grant of Awards to the Connected Selected Participants, including the list of Connected Selected Participants and the specific number of Award Shares underlying such Awards to be granted to the Connected Selected Participants, shall be determined by the Board and/or the Delegate pursuant to the relevant authorization to be granted by the Shareholders at general meeting, and taking into account the following factors in principal, which include but are not limited to, (i) the total number of H Shares acquired by the Scheme Trustee as the source of the Award Shares under the Scheme; (ii) the ranking of the Connected Selected Participants; and (iii) the individual performance appraisal results of the Connected Selected Participants. As at the date of this announcement, the Connected Selected Participants are expected to include Dr. Ge Li, Dr. Minzhang Chen, Mr. Edward Hu, Dr. Steve Qing Yang, Mr. Zhaohui Zhang, Ms. Ming Shi, Dr. Hao Wu, Mr. Feng Zhang, Ms. Minfang Zhu, Ms. Wendy J. Hu and Ms. Jingna Kang.

The Conditions of Grant are set with reference to the expected revenue of the Group for the year 2025. On March 17, 2025, the Company disclosed in its annual results announcement of the year ended December 31, 2024 that revenue is expected to reach RMB41.5 billion to RMB43 billion in 2025. The Basic Condition of Grant was thus correspondingly set with reference to the expected revenue of the Group for the year 2025 being RMB42 billion or above, and the Additional Condition of Grant was thus correspondingly set with reference to the expected revenue of the Group for the year 2025 being RMB43 billion or above.

Subject to the approval of the resolutions in relation to the 2025 Scheme by the Shareholders at the 2024 AGM, if the Condition(s) of Grant are satisfied and the relevant grant of Awards to the Selected Participants which corresponds to the satisfied Condition(s) of Grant takes effect, the Awards shall vest in accordance with the criteria, conditions and schedule as further particularized in the 2025 Scheme Rules and the Award Letter. If the Condition(s) of Grant cannot be satisfied, the relevant grant of Awards to such Selected Participants which corresponds to the unsatisfied Condition(s) of Grant will not take effect.

Vesting of the Awards

The Board or the Delegatee may determine the vesting criteria and conditions or periods for the Awards to be vested.

Vesting schedule

Unless otherwise specified in the Award Letter approved by the Board or the Delegatee, the Vesting Periods of the Awards granted under the 2025 Scheme are as follows:

(A) For Awards to be granted to Selected Participants who are Eligible Employees as at the date on which the 2025 Scheme is approved by the Shareholders at the 2024 AGM:

Vesting Periods Proportion of Vesting
First Vesting Period Within the month of December 2026 25%
Second Vesting Period Within the month of December 2027 25%
Third Vesting Period Within the month of December 2028 25%
Fourth Vesting Period Within the month of December 2029 25%

(B) For Awards to be granted to Selected Participants who (i) shall become Eligible Employees subsequent to the date on which the 2025 Scheme is approved by the Shareholders at the 2024 AGM; and (ii) shall have been given the entitlement to be granted Awards pursuant to the relevant offer letters to be issued by the Company in connection with their employment within the Group:

Vesting Periods Proportion of Vesting
First Vesting Period Within the year immediately following the first anniversary of the commencement date of the employment of the Selected Participant with the relevant member of the Group 0%

Vesting Periods Proportion of Vesting
Second Vesting Period Within the year immediately following the second anniversary of the commencement date of the employment of the Selected Participant with the relevant member of the Group 25%
Third Vesting Period Within the year immediately following the third anniversary of the commencement date of the employment of the Selected Participant with the relevant member of the Group 25%
Fourth Vesting Period Within the year immediately following the fourth anniversary of the commencement date of the employment of the Selected Participant with the relevant member of the Group 50%

The Vesting Periods of the Awards granted under any subsequent grant of the 2025 Scheme or the Awards to be satisfied by the application of any Returned Shares shall be determined by the Board or the Delegate in its sole and absolute discretion, and shall in any event not extend beyond the then remaining term of the Award Period at the time of grant.

Vesting Conditions

Vesting of the Awards granted under the 2025 Scheme is subject to conditions of the individual performance indicators of the Selected Participants, and any other applicable vesting conditions as set out in the Award Letter.

The individual performance indicators of the Selected Participants are as follows:

According to the applicable performance management rules to be adopted by the Company, the Board or the Delegate shall carry out annual comprehensive appraisal on the Selected Participants and determine the actual vesting amount of the Awards granted under the 2025 Scheme accordingly. The actual vesting amount of the Award granted to a Selected Participant for the respective Vesting Periods shall be equal to the standard coefficient $\times$ the planned vesting amount for the respective Vesting Periods. The coefficient for individual performance appraisal results of grade B- (or its equivalent appraisal result such as "satisfactory") or above is $100\%$ whereas the coefficient for individual performance appraisal results below grade B- is 0.


In respect of Selected Participants who are PRC employees, the performance appraisal results comprise five grades, namely A+, A, B, C and D. For PRC employees who are management personnel at the level of senior director or above, the performance appraisal results comprise eight grades, namely A+, A, A-, B+, B, B-, C and D. In respect of Selected Participants who are non-PRC employees, the performance appraisal results comprise five grades, namely "excellent", "outstanding", "satisfactory", "partially pass" and "fail".

The performance appraisal is conducted annually and the process involves: (i) employee self-appraisal; (ii) performance appraisal evaluator conducts objective evaluation based on feedback and recommendations on the employee as well as the performance of the employee; (iii) performance appraisal reviewer conducts review of the performance appraisal results; and (iv) relevant persons-in-charge of the various business and operational units approves the performance appraisal results, and the appraisal results of management personnel at the level of senior director or above shall be approved by a chief executive officer of the Company.

The performance appraisal encompasses three aspects, namely job responsibilities, operational performance and core values. The supervisors of the relevant employees will conduct objective evaluation of the performance appraisal results based on the collected appraisal information (including records of work results, work summary of the relevant employees and performance appraisal feedback and recommendations) and the individual performance targets of the relevant employees. In terms of core values, the supervisors of the relevant employees will conduct an integrated evaluation based on parameters including key events, upstream and downstream work evaluation and peer evaluation.

If the Selected Participant fails to fulfil the individual performance indicators above, all the Award Shares underlying the relevant Awards which may otherwise be vested during the respective Vesting Periods shall not be vested and shall be held by the Scheme Trustee as Returned Shares for application towards future Awards in accordance with the 2025 Scheme Rules for the purpose of the 2025 Scheme.

10. CHANGES OF CIRCUMSTANCES PERTAINING TO THE SELECTED PARTICIPANTS

10.1 If a Selected Participant changes his/her job position in the Group, the out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all continue to vest in accordance with the Vesting Dates set out in the Award Letter, unless the Board or the Delegate determines otherwise in its sole and absolute discretion. However, if a Selected Participant has a change in job position due to any of the following reasons:

(a) he/she is not qualified for his/her job;

(b) violates laws, violates professional ethics, reveals confidential information of the Company;

(c) fails to discharge his/her duties or has committed wilful misconduct, materially violates the policies of the Group;

(d) causing damages to the interest or reputation of the Group; or

(e) the Group terminates his/her employment contract for any of the above reasons,

any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all be immediately forfeited, unless the Board or the Delegate determines otherwise in its sole and absolute discretion.

  • APP-19 -

10.2 If a Selected Participant ceases to be an Eligible Employee by reason of disqualification from participating in the Scheme due to any of the reasons set forth in Rule 6.2 under which no one should be considered as a Selected Participant, any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all be immediately forfeited, unless the Board or the Delegate determines otherwise in its sole and absolute discretion.

10.3 If a Selected Participant ceases to be an Eligible Employee by reason of leaving the Group due to resignation or redundancy, expiration or termination of labor contract by the Group, any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all be immediately forfeited, unless the Board or the Delegate determines otherwise in its sole and absolute discretion.

10.4 If a Selected Participant ceases to be an Eligible Employee by reason of termination of the Selected Participant's employment or contractual engagement with the Group or resignation due to incapacity resulting from work injury, any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all continue to vest in accordance with the Vesting Dates set out in the Award Letter, unless the Board or the Delegate determines otherwise in its sole and absolute discretion.

10.5 Subject to Rules 10.11 and 12.1(f), if a Selected Participant passes away due to work injury, on the date of the occurrence of such event, any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all vest immediately and the vesting conditions as stipulated in the relevant award letter shall be disregarded.

10.6 Subject to Rules 10.11 and 12.1(f), given the exceptional and invaluable contribution of employees with a human resources ranking at director (主任) level or above (the "Relevant Employees"), if a Relevant Employee passes away not due to work injury, on the date of the occurrence of such event, any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all vest immediately and the vesting conditions as stipulated in the relevant award letter shall be disregarded. If a Selected Participant who is not a Relevant Employee passes away not due to work injury, on the date of the occurrence of such event, any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all be immediately forfeited, unless the Board or the Delegate determines otherwise in its sole and absolute discretion.

10.7 If a Selected Participant is declared bankrupt or becomes insolvent or makes any arrangements or composition with his or her creditors generally, any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all be immediately forfeited, unless the Board or the Delegate determines otherwise in its sole and absolute discretion.

  • APP-20 -

10.8 If a Selected Participant fails, during the course of his employment, to devote whole of his time and attention to the business of the Group or to use his best endeavours to develop the business and interests of the Group (as determined by the Board or the Delegatee in its sole and absolute discretion), any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all be immediately forfeited, unless the Board or the Delegatee determines otherwise in its sole and absolute discretion.

10.9 If a Selected Participant is in breach of his contract of employment of the Group or any other obligation to the Group (including without limitation the restrictive covenants as set out in Rule 13), any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all be immediately forfeited, unless the Board or the Delegatee determines otherwise in its sole and absolute discretion.

10.10 If a Selected Participant ceases to be an Eligible Employee for reasons other than those set out in Rules 10.1 to 10.9, any outstanding Award Shares not yet vested shall be immediately forfeited, unless the Board or the Delegatee determines otherwise in its sole absolute discretion.

10.11 In the event that an Award or any part thereof to a Selected Participant vests by reason of the death of such Selected Participant, the Scheme Trustee shall hold such number of Awards Shares as are equal to the vested Award Shares or the Actual Selling Price (the "Benefits") on trust and to transfer the same to the legal personal representatives of the Selected Participant within two years of the death of the Selected Participant (or such longer period as the Scheme Trustee and the Company shall agree from time to time) or, if the Benefits would otherwise become bona vacantia, the Benefits shall be forfeited and cease to be transferable and such Benefits shall be held by the Scheme Trustee as Returned Shares or funds of the Trust for the purposes of the Scheme. Notwithstanding the foregoing, the Benefits held upon the trusts hereof shall until transfer is made in accordance herewith be retained and may be invested and otherwise dealt with by the Scheme Trustee in every way as if they had remained part of the Trust.

  • APP-21 -

10.12 The Company shall, from time to time, inform the Scheme Trustee in writing, the date in which such Selected Participant ceased to be an Eligible Employee and any amendments to the terms and conditions of the Award in respect to such Selected Participant (including the number of Award Shares entitled).

10.13 If a Selected Participant’s employment relationship with the Group is terminated by any reason, (i) all Award Shares so vested shall be sold, on-market at the prevailing market price, within three months of such termination of employment relationship with the Group; and (ii) after the expiry of the three month period as set out in Rule 10.13(i), the Company reserves the right to direct and procure the Scheme Trustee to sell, on-market and at the prevailing market price, all Award Shares so vested but not sold by the Selected Participant pursuant to Rules 9 and 10.13(i).
